US State Department approved sale of over three thousand ERAM cruise missiles to Ukraine

The US Department of State has approved the sale of $825 million in military aid to Ukraine. The package includes 3,350 ERAM missiles and integrated GPS/INS navigation systems.

First official images of the Ukrainian "Long Neptune" missile with a range of 1000 km have appearedPhoto

The long-range version of the Ukrainian cruise missile "Long Neptune", which has been under development since 2023, has been publicly demonstrated for the first time. It can hit the enemy at a distance of up to 1000 km, has an increased fuselage diameter and a length of more than 6 meters.

New Zealand invests $1.6 billion in naval helicopters and Airbus aircraft, responding to growing threats

New Zealand will spend $1. 6 billion on five MH-60R naval helicopters and two Airbus A321XLR aircraft. This is the largest investment since the decision to modernize the outdated equipment of the defense fleet.
